Hi Marisol, handing over the Tidecrest export pipeline. Failed exports retry automatically three times with exponential backoff; after that they land in the dead-letter queue and need a manual requeue via the ops console. Check the batch checksum before requeuing, or you'll duplicate rows downstream. One last thing: the requeue job must be signed before the scheduler accepts it, so use the signing key below.

rollout seal: bky3_Zik

Ticket QR-2291: Report exports from the Ledgermint dashboard currently stamp timestamps in server-local time rather than the account's configured timezone, causing discrepancies in compliance extracts. The fix normalizes all export timestamps to UTC with an explicit offset column. Security review is required because export formatting touches the audit trail. Sign-off must come from the reviewer named below.

account owner for bawip-tahag: Raleth Quenok

# Heads up, plugin authors: this constant controls where the extraction
# script for Polyglotta looks for your translation strings. Don't rename
# your `strings/` folder or the scanner will silently skip it — yes,
# silently, we know, it's on the list. Run the extractor locally before
# shipping and paste the token it prints at the bottom of its summary.

pipeline stamp: htk9_ce63042d9